Exegesis

Two prepositional phrases, le-kashdayya {לכשדיא | lə-kaš-da-yā} and le-kashdaei {לְכַשְׂדָּאֵ֔י | lə-kaś-dā-ʾê}, specify the Chaldean audience.

In contextDaniel 2:5

The king answered and said to the Chaldeans, “The word from me is firm: if you do not make known to me the dream and its interpretation, you shall be made into pieces, and your houses shall be set as a dunghill .”

About this coordinate

Daniel 2:5:4 is a BCV:P reference — Book · Chapter · Verse · Word Position. It addresses word 4 of Daniel 2:5, so the Hebrew word לכשדיא (lekhasedia) can be cited, linked and studied at exactly this position rather than somewhere in the verse. In the Biblical Knowledge Coordinate System the same position is written Dan.2.5.W4, which extends further down to each syllable (Dan.2.5.W4.S1) and character.
